FR6F31420882 is the International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) for the recording "Jour de joie" by Herbert Léonard, released 1993-01-01. ISRCs are 12-character ISO 3901 identifiers that uniquely tag a specific sound recording — different masters, remixes, and live versions each receive a distinct ISRC.
